    NEWS - New York: Demonstration für die Pressefreiheit
    February 26, 2017 - New York City, New York, US - Hundreds of activists stood in silence outside the New York Times' headquarters on West 41st Street in midtown Manhattan Sunday in a show of solidarity with the press, for the second time in two days. The rally organized after the Trump White House banned several major news outlets, including The New York Times and CNN, from an off-camera briefing on Friday. Some of the protesters duct taped their mouths shut as they stood with copies of the New York Times. Others held protest signs that said, ''This is not fake news,'' and ''Support the Free Press.'' Protesters ended the march at the Fox News Network headquarters on Sixth Avenue (FOTO: DUKAS/ZUMA)
